Craig Vaughan is the Chief Executive Officer of Vaughan Capital Advisors. He has spent 19 years executing commercial and strategic transactions at the intersection of media and technology. He has closed over $5 billion in transaction volume during his career.

Craig began his investment banking career with Goldman Sachs in the Communications, Media and Entertainment group. Before founding VCA, he was a Senior Executive at Creative Artists Agency (“CAA”), executing M&A and fund formation transactions.

Prior to joining CAA, Craig held strategic transaction roles at 21st Century Fox and Sony Pictures. Mr. Vaughan was a founding advisor to the Queens Bridge Fund. Craig began his career in middle-market debt financing at Nations Bank (now Bank of America).

Craig holds an M.B.A. in Finance from Michigan’s Ross Business School and a B.A. in Finance from the University of Texas at Austin. He is registered with FINRA with Series 79, 62, and 63 licenses.

Keith’s focus at Vaughan Capital Advisors includes optimizing the client service and transaction process through operations management and the use of technology platforms. Keith has 20 years of experience managing complex, time-sensitive, transaction-oriented operations in senior executive positions at London based MICE Group, PLC, Ybrant Digital (Lycos), AdDynamix, Universal Studios and Universal Music.

Keith’s transaction experience includes managing over $400 million of design and engineering contracts for the $2.1 billion Universal Studios Japan Project. Keith also served as the Global Asset Manager for Universal Music Group IT services managing relationships with Equant, Oracle, British Telecom, and AT&T. In 2016 he worked with the Clear View Group out of Austin, TX to advise on digital operations planning after the private equity firm’s acquisition of Ebony Magazine.
Keith graduated with a B.S. in Communications from Bridgewater State University.

Ella Vaughan is the President of Marketing and Operations at Vaughan Capital Advisors. She has over 15 years of experience in consumer, brand, integrated and digital marketing across media and entertainment industries.

Prior to VCA, Ella was a marketing executive at FremantleMedia where she led digital, social media, and integrated marketing strategies for FremantleMedia’s major television programs, including American Idol and America’s Got Talent. Key digital and integrated marketing executions included live Facebook integrations for American Idol, fan voting via Google, and coordinating digital content sales on Apple’s iTunes.

Prior to FremantleMedia she held roles planning, developing and executing film, TV, and online marketing programs at Nickelodeon, E! Entertainment, The Style Network, Fox and Sony.

Ella holds an M.B.A. from Pepperdine’s Graziadio School of Business and a B.A. in Psychology from the University of California, Los Angeles.

Susan Casey Stone is a senior transaction advisor at Vaughan Capital Advisors. She is the founder of Sierra Wasatch Capital (“SWC”), a venture capital firm investing in digital media start-ups in the Los Angeles area. She also is on the Board of Directors of Iris.TV in L.A., Thumzap in Tel Aviv, and Ubiquitous Energy in Redwood City, CA. Prior to SWC, Susan managed venture capital investments for Los Angeles-based family office Riverhorse Investments, Inc., where she invested in the digital media and cleantech sectors.

Before joining Riverhorse, Susan was a Senior Vice President in the Media and Entertainment Group at Houlihan Lokey in Los Angeles, where she provided strategic advice on buy-side, sell-side, leveraged buyout, and minority investment transactions. Susan began her career at J.P. Morgan Securities in New York, where she was a Vice President in the Technology, Media and Telecommunications Group and an Associate in the Mergers & Acquisitions Group.

Susan is a graduate of Yale University and earned her M.B.A in Finance with honors from Georgetown University’s McDonough School of Business.
